Developing an effective camera system requires designers to understand both technical limitations and human perception. A third-person adventure may need a viewpoint that follows movement smoothly while keeping important surroundings visible, whereas a racing title requires precise positioning that communicates speed and direction clearly. Puzzle experiences often depend on camera angles that help players recognize patterns, distances, and hidden relationships between objects. Designers continuously test different perspectives to determine which positions provide useful information without reducing the sense of discovery. Behind every smooth camera movement exists a complex combination of programming, animation, and level design. Engineers create systems that prevent the viewpoint from passing through objects, while designers establish rules for when the camera should adjust automatically or allow complete manual control. Advanced algorithms can analyze surrounding environments, predict potential obstacles, and reposition perspectives before problems occur. Accessibility specialists also contribute by developing settings that allow users to customize sensitivity, distance, and movement behavior according to personal preferences.
